Historical Context and Origins
The roots of the conflict extend far beyond the immediate events of 2022, tracing back to the dissolution of the Soviet Union. The Ukraine conflict wiki details the Euromaidan protests of 2013-2014, which led to the ousting of President Viktor Yanukovych and set the stage for Russian intervention. Subsequent entries explore the annexation of Crimea and the outbreak of war in the Donbas region, where Russian-backed separatists declared independence in the Donetsk and Luansk People's Republics.
